Title :
Commissioning the Astra Gemini petawatt Ti:sapphire laser system

Abstract :
Astra Gemini is a dual-beam petawatt Ti:sapphire laser at the Rutherford Appleton Laboratory in the U.K. We report measurements characterising the laser beam quality, pulse energy, and pulse duration of the first beam line.
